About 32 Halton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

32 Halton Lane is a five-bedroom detached house in Wendover, Aylesbury, Aylesbury (HP22 6AR). It has a recorded floor area of 210 m² (around 2260 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(July 2017) shows an E (score 49),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 73),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a self-contained annexe and attached land beyond the plot.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.

At 210 m² the property is well over the postcode median (142 m² across 19 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 89% of similar EPCs). 3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£1,147,000 is 33.4%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£380/sq ft) was about 31.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£860,000 in September 2019.
